The BMW LIM module is a CCS, CHAdeMO and AC charging controller. It is used to communicate between the vehicle and the public charging infrastructure, to allow fast charging to occur.
As these can be found affordably on eBay and from auto wreckers, they have been pursued as an open-source charger project.

Connectors and Pinouts

Label | Description | Compatible Plugs |
---|---|---|
4B | 12 Pin Connector | BMW 61138373632
Audi 4E0 972 713 TE 1534152-1 / 1534151-1 |
3B | 8 Pin Connector (CHAdeMO models only) | BMW 61138364624
Audi 4F0 972 708 TE 1-1534229-1 |
1B | 16 Pin Connector | Hirschmann 805-587-545 |
2B | 6 Pin Connector | BMW 61138383300
Audi 7M0 973 119 TE 1-967616-1 |
X | Replacement Pins | 5-962885-1 |
X | Rubber Seal | 1-967067-1 |
Pin # | Function | Description |
---|---|---|
1B-1 | LED_S | Lighting Charge Socket |
1B-2 | ZV_LKL+ | Charge Door Lock Motor |
1B-3 | LED_M | Lighting Charge Socket |
1B-4 | ZV_LADE+ | Hood Lock |
1B-5 | ZV_LADE- | Hood Lock |
1B-6 | CAN | |
1B-7 | CAN | |
1B-8 | Wake up signal | |
1B-9 | Power | |
1B-10 | Ground | |
1B-11 | ||
1B-12 | ||
1B-13 | SENS_LKL | Charge Door Lock Sensor |
1B-14 | ZV_LKL- | Charge Door Lock Sensor |
1B-15 | CHARGE_E | Goes to KLE. Guessing this is charge enabled signal for the in car charger? |
1B-16 | ZV_LADE | Hood Lock |
Pin # | Function | Description |
---|---|---|
2B-1 | Pilot | |
2B-2 | Proxy | |
2B-3 | Diag? Looped back to Pin 4? | |
2B-4 | ||
2B-5 | GND | Ground. (Charge Socket) |
2B-6 |
3B Pinout:
- N/A
Pin # | Function | Description |
---|---|---|
4B-1 | HV+_SZ+ | Contactor Control |
4B-2 | HV-_SZ+ | Contactor Control |
4B-3 | HV+_SZ- | Contactor Control |
4B-4 | HV-_SZ- | Contactor Control |
4B-5 | U_HV_DC | |
4B-6 | LED_RT | Charge Status Light |
4B-7 | LED_GN | Charge Status Light |
4B-8 | LED_BL | Charge Status Light |
4B-9 | BR_GND | Charge Status Light |
4B-10 | ZV_LS- | Charge Socket Locking |
4B-11 | ZV_LS+ | Charge Socket Locking |
4B-12 | SENS_LS | Charge Socket Locking |
